That the censor catch things it isn't supposed to catch is a shame. I am personally not a big fan of censoring things, but I do see the necessity of having a censor, and the censor is indeed updated often. I believe Jagex do the best they can to get the censor not catching things it shouldn't.

 

 

 

 

 

 

 

One thing to keep in mind is the purpose of the censor. Sure, it is there to stop people saying bad words. Even more important is that it is there to remind people that they should not talk about those things.

 

 

 

 

 

 

 

Take the words phone or adress for example. You can get around them easily by saying fone or addy. But it is censored to tell/remind kids that they should not give out phone numbers to people they only know from in game. Same thing with adress, it serves as a reminder to not give out real life adress, or mail adress or any kind of adress to strangers. Ah well, that was a little off topic, sorry.
